HOUSE RESOLUTION

 
2    WHEREAS, Sexual assault is a violent crime and has
3devastating safety and health implications for every person in
4Illinois, whether they are a victim, survivor, family member,
5loved one, friend, neighbor, or co-worker of a victim; and
 
6    WHEREAS, The nation's largest anti-sexual violence
7organization, Rape, Abuse, and Incest National Network (RAINN)
8found that one out of every six American women has been the
9victim of an attempted or completed sexual assault in her
10lifetime, and one in every 33 American men have experienced an
11attempted or completed sexual assault in his lifetime; and
 
12    WHEREAS, The Illinois Criminal Justice Information
13Authority and the Illinois Coalition Against Sexual Assault
14(ICASA) found that more than 37,000 victims of sexual violence
15received services from an ICASA rape crisis center in Illinois
16between July 1, 2010 and June 30, 2015; and
 
17    WHEREAS, The data from ICASA shows that an average of
1810,200 victims were served annually; 60 percent of these
19victims were adults and 40 percent were children aged 17 years
20or younger; and
 
21    WHEREAS, In addition, ICASA's rape crisis centers

1responded to more than 42,000 requests from anonymous
2individuals for crisis intervention service during the period
3of 2010 through 2015, and averaged 8,500 visits per year; and
 
4    WHEREAS, End Violence Against Women International has
5developed a public awareness campaign entitled "Start by
6Believing," a message that, in part, confronts the reality that
7many victims do not get the support they need when they do
8report a crime; and
 
9    WHEREAS, It is important for the State of Illinois to
10support this message and victims of sexual assault, so that
11they may heal; therefore, be it
 
12    RESOLVED, BY TH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ES OF THE ONE
13HUNDREDTH G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F THE STATE OF ILLINOIS, that we
14declare April 4, 2018 as "Start by Believing Day" in the State
15of Illinois.
